  11. They seem to slightly "remaster" every song/demo before it's going onto a LPU CD. I'm sure they amplify/hard-limit the songs before, kinda makes sense of course (as they will 'sound' better afterwards). Here's the waveform of In The End compared to the old demos we have: Untitled from the 1999 & 2000 Demo CDs we have In The End on this CD I'd say we can assume that no demo (at least not the old ones) we find on new LPU CDs are exactly "the same" as Mike finds them his closet/wherever, they're not 'untouched'. However, this is not necessarily a bad thing, as a CD with every track mastered the same way/same volume level is much more enjoyable. For the collector it would be nice to have the 'unmastered' versions too, of course^^ Just hope the original files they played with were actually lossless, as previous LPU CDs seemed to be made out of lossy files.
